Hey everyone!
This will be my last update to my clutch saga. I removed the white grommet clutch stop and everything feels like normal. Engagement point is gradually improving and all gears are accessible. If you’re on the fence, rest easy. Performance plate works. Definitely remove that grommet though if you already have a PTB clutch and are still getting notchy shifts. Pics for attention. |
